Dr. Vikas Agarwal is Visiting Research Fellow at the BNP Paribas Hedge Fund Centre, London Business School. He is also Assistant Professor of Finance at the J.Mack Robinson College of Business, Georgia State University, where he teaches undergraduate and masters electives in finance. He has previously taught at the University of Cologne and the K.J.Somaiya Institute of Management.
His research interests include asset pricing, portfolio management, hedge and mutual funds, performance evaluation and capital markets. Vikas has won an array of awards from various institutions, including the European Finance Association, and has written extensively on Hedge Funds.
Vikas holds a B.Tech, and MBA and a Ph.D in Finance, from London Business School
